概述

2022年,全球乳化维生素D3市场达到5.8811亿美元,预计2030年将达到8.9574亿美元,2023-2030年预测期间CAGR为5.4%。

现代生活方式往往导致在户外工作、休閒或防晒的时间减少,限制了皮肤中天然维生素 D 的产生,而皮肤是大多数人的主要来源。维生素 D3 是骨骼健康、骨质疏鬆症和佝偻病防治所需的重要维生素。它具有多种作用,用于食品、饲料和医疗保健行业。骨质疏鬆症、自体免疫疾病和某些癌症等慢性疾病的全球盛行率正在上升。

维生素 D 充足与降低某些疾病的风险有关,从而推动了乳化维生素 D3 的市场。乳化维生素D3有多种剂型,如滴剂和咀嚼片,方便不同年龄层和喜好的人食用。人们对维生素 D 缺乏症的认识不断提高、可支配收入增加以及新医疗保健技术的不断采用等因素都有助于全球市场的扩张。

北美主导了全球乳化维生素 D3 市场。根据骨骼健康与骨质疏鬆基金会 2021 年 8 月的数据,大约 1,000 万美国人患有骨质疏鬆症,另外 4,400 万美国人骨密度低,这使他们面临更大的风险。 5,400 万美国人(占 50 岁及以上成年人的一半)面临骨折风险,应该关注骨骼健康。用于治疗各种缺乏症的维生素 D 的高需求正在推动市场成长。

动力学

全球维生素缺乏症日益严重

根据美国国立卫生研究院统计,2023年7月,全球约有10亿人缺乏维生素D,50%的人口维生素D不足。随着人们对维生素D缺乏症的认识不断提高,人们越来越需要补充维生素缺乏症以维持良好的健康状况,因此增加了维生素D3的补充。

根据2017年至2020年3月进行的全国健康与营养调查,约3%的年轻人和18.5%的成年人报告使用维生素D补充剂。在那些报告服用维生素 D 补充剂的人中,33.9% 的年轻人和 66.9% 的成年人连续 30 天每天服用补充剂。应对维生素缺乏症的补充需求越高,由于乳化维生素 D3 的有效性质,对它的需求也越大。

乳化维生素 D3 的好处

乳化维生素D3补充剂提供了一种简单有效的方法来增加维生素D摄取量,不受阳光照射或饮食限制的影响,增加日常生活中的补充习惯。随着人们对维生素 D 缺乏症的认识不断增强,乳化 D3 瞄准了更广泛的年龄范围,从年轻人到关注骨骼健康的老年人。维生素 D 与多种健康益处有关,乳化产品以其更好的吸收性和便利性迎合了人们对预防措施的关注。

乳化过程将维生素 D3 分解成更小的颗粒,与传统的片剂或胶囊相比,可以更好地在肠道中吸收。这对于有消化问题或无法有效吸收营养的人尤其有益。乳化维生素 D3 有多种形式,如滴剂和软糖,使儿童、老年人或吞嚥药片有困难的人更容易食用。

乳化维生素D3成本高

传统的维生素 D3 补充剂的製造相对简单。它们涉及混合干燥成分并将其压製成片剂或胶囊。乳化选项需要额外的步骤。维生素 D3 需要使用特殊的乳化剂分散到液体载体。此製程较为复杂,需专用设备,导致生产成本较高。

乳化配方通常使用油和乳化剂等附加成分来形成稳定的乳液。与传统补充剂中使用的简单成分相比,这些额外成分会增加整体成本。与传统维生素D3相比,乳化维生素D3的生产流程和成分使其成本更高。对价格敏感的客户选择低价产品,阻碍了市场成长。

Overview

Global Emulsified Vitamin D3 Market reached US$ 588.11 million in 2022 and is expected to reach US$ 895.74 million by 2030, growing with a CAGR of 5.4% during the forecast period 2023-2030.

Modern lifestyles often involve spending less time outdoors for work, leisure or sun protection, limiting natural vitamin D production in the skin, a primary source for most people. Vitamin D3 is an important vitamin needed for bone health osteoporosis and rickets aversion. It has various roles and is used in the food, feed and healthcare industries. The global prevalence of chronic diseases like osteoporosis, autoimmune disorders, and certain cancers is on the rise.

Vitamin D sufficiency is linked to a reduced risk of developing some of the various conditions, propelling the market for emulsified vitamin D3. Emulsified vitamin D3 comes in various forms like liquid drops and chewable tablets, making them easy to consume for different age groups and preferences. Factors like rising awareness of vitamin D deficiency, increasing disposable income, and growing adoption of new healthcare technologies contribute to market expansion globally.

North America dominated the global emulsified vitamin D3 market. According to Bone Health & Osteoporosis Foundation August 2021, approximately 10 million Americans have osteoporosis and another 44 million have low bone density, placing them at increased risk. 54 million Americans, half of all adults age 50 and older, are at risk of breaking a bone and should be concerned about bone health. The high demand for vitamin D to deal with various deficiency disorders is driving market growth.

Dynamics

Increasing Vitamin Deficiency Worldwide

According to the National Institutes of Health, in July 2023, about 1 billion people worldwide had vitamin D deficiency, while 50% of the population had vitamin D insufficiency. With growing awareness of vitamin D deficiency, there is a greater need for supplementation for vitamin deficiency to maintain good health conditions, increasing the supplementation for vitamin D3.

According to the National Health and Nutrition Examination Survey conducted from 2017 to March 2020, around 3% of young people and 18.5% of adults reported using vitamin D supplements. Of those who reported using vitamin D supplements, 33.9% of young people and 66.9% of adults took the supplement every day for 30 days. The higher the need for supplementation to deal with vitamin deficiencies, there is also greater demand for the emulsified vitamin D3 due to its effective nature.

Benefits of Emulsified Vitamin D3

Emulsified vitamin D3 supplements provide a simple and effective way to increase vitamin D intake, regardless of sun exposure or dietary limitations, increasing the supplementation habits in daily life. With growing awareness of vitamin D deficiency, emulsified D3 is targeting a wider age range, from young adults to seniors concerned about bone health. Vitamin D is linked to various health benefits, and emulsified options cater to this focus on preventative measures with their improved absorption and convenience.

The emulsification process breaks down vitamin D3 into smaller particles, allowing for better absorption in the gut compared to traditional tablets or capsules. This is especially beneficial for individuals with digestive issues or those who may not absorb nutrients effectively. Emulsified vitamin D3 comes in various forms like liquid drops and gummies, making it easier to consume for children, elderly individuals, or those who have trouble swallowing pills.

High-Cost of Emulsified Vitamin D3

Traditional vitamin D3 supplements are relatively simple to manufacture. They involve mixing dry ingredients and compressing them into tablets or capsules. Emulsified options require additional steps. The vitamin D3 needs to be dispersed into a liquid carrier using special emulsifying agents. This process is more complex and requires specialised equipment, contributing to higher production costs.

Emulsified formulas often use additional ingredients like oils and emulsifiers to create a stable emulsion. These additional ingredients can add to the overall cost compared to the simpler ingredients used in traditional supplements. The production process and ingredients of the emulsified vitamin D3 make them costlier compared to traditional vitamin D3. Price-sensitive customers choose low-priced products hindering the market growth.

High Vitamin D Deficiency Among Adult Population

The global emulsified vitamin D3 market is segmented based on target audience into infants and children, pregnant and lactating women and adults. Each target audience benefits from the emulsified vitamin D3 in a similar manner, but the need and use of vitamin D3 among adults is higher compared to other age groups driving the segment growth. According to the August 2022, American Academy of Pediatrics 32% of young adults were deficient in vitamin D.

In the adult population, 35% of adults in United States are vitamin D deficient whereas over 80% of adults in Pakistan, India, and Bangladesh are vitamin D deficient. Similarly, 61% of the elderly population is vitamin D deficient in United States, whereas 90% in Turkey, 96% in India, 72% in Pakistan, and 67% in Iran were vitamin D deficient. To deal with the increasing deficiencies among the age groups, there is a higher demand for emulsified vitamin D3 for an efficient vitamin supply into the body.

Geographical Penetration

High Prevalence of Vitamin Deficiency in North America

North America dominated the global emulsified vitamin D3 market. Regional countries such as United States and Canada have a high prevalence of vitamin D deficiency. In the United States, 47% of African American infants and 56% of Caucasian infants have vitamin D deficiency. About 50% to 60% of nursing home residents and hospitalized patients have vitamin D deficiency in U.S.

Public health campaigns and media attention have raised awareness of this issue, leading to increased interest in vitamin D supplementation. People in North America are increasingly interested in preventive healthcare and taking a proactive approach to managing their health. The North American market is often receptive to new technologies and products. Emulsified Vitamin D3 is a relatively innovation, and North American companies are quicker to adopt and manufacture it compared to other regions.

COVID-19 Impact Analysis

The COVID-19 pandemic had both positive and negative impact on the global market. The pandemic caused disruptions in global supply chains for raw materials and manufacturing processes. This led to temporary shortages or price fluctuations for emulsified Vitamin D3 supplements. The economic impact of COVID-19 has led some consumers to cut back on discretionary spending, potentially affecting sales of non-essential items like vitamin supplements.

The pandemic highlighted the importance of a strong immune system. Research studies suggesting a potential link between vitamin D sufficiency and reduced risk of respiratory infections have boosted interest in vitamin D supplementation. This has likely driven demand for emulsified vitamin D3 due to its potentially better absorption. A surge in e-commerce for various products, including health supplements, had a positive impact on the market as well.
